LSU left-handed pitcher Kade Anderson had an early scare in Game 1 of the Baton Rouge super regional against West Virginia.
Anderson got hit on his throwing arm by a line drive from West Virginia second baseman Gavin Kelly, setting up first and second with no outs for the Mountaineers after designated hitter Sam White recorded a leadoff single. Anderson stayed in the game after getting checked out by LSU's staff.
A sacrifice bunt by West Virginia center fielder Skylar King set up second and third and one out. Right fielder Jace Reinhart grounded out to third base to get White across the plate for a 1-0 lead, with Kelly advancing to third base.
Anderson got out of the inning with only one run allowed after striking out West Virginia first baseman Ben Lumsden to end the inning.
